According to The Insight Partners market research study titled ‘Whole Exome Sequencing Market to 2027 – Global Analysis and Forecasts by Product & Service, Technology, Application and Geography. The global whole exome sequencing market is expected to reach US$ 3,812.0 Mn in 2027 from US$ 755.68 Mn in 2018. The market is estimated to grow with a CAGR of 19.8% from 2019-2027. The report highlights the trends prevalent in the global whole exome sequencing market and the factors driving the market along with those that act as challenges to its growth.

 

Global whole exome sequencing market was segmented by product & service, technology, and application. On the basis of the product & service, the market is segmented as systems, kits and services. Services segment is further sub-segmented into sequencing services and data analysis (bioinformatics) and other services. Based on the technology, the whole exome sequencing market is segmented into sequencing by synthesis, ion semiconductor sequencing and other technologies. On the basis of the application, the whole exome sequencing market is segmented into diagnostics, drug discovery & development, personalized medicine and others. Diagnostics segment is further sub-segmented into cancer diagnostics, monogenic (mendelian) disorders diagnostics, monogenic types of diabetes diagnostics and HIV diagnostics and other diagnostics.

 

The market for whole exome sequencing is expected to grow significantly due to factors such as reduction in time and cost for sequencing, rising need of molecular diagnosis and increasing application in drug discovery are likely to drive the growth of the whole exome sequencing market.

 

The major players operating in the whole exome sequencing market include,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c., Illumina, Inc., Centogene AG, F. Hoffmann-La Roche AG, Psomagen, Inc. (previuosly Macrogen Corp.), Pacific Biosciences of California, Inc., Brooks Automation, Inc. (GENEWIZ, Inc.), Bio-Rad Laboratories, Inc., Eurofins Scientific and Stratos Genomics.
